出 处:《中国综合临床》2013年第10期1036-1039,共4页Clinical Medicine of China
摘 要:目的探讨糖尿病人群估测肾小球滤过率(eGFR)的分布情况及其影响因素。方法以2006—2007年参加开滦集团健康体检的2型糖尿病人群为9396例为观察队列,将研究对象按年龄〈40岁、40~60岁、60—80岁、≥80岁进行分组,以eGFR〈60ml/(min·1.73m。)定义为肾功能不全事件,应用多因素logistic回归模型分析影响发生肾功能不全的因素。结果研究对象的eGFR在年龄〈40岁、40—60岁、60—80岁、t〉80岁组随年龄的增加而降低(F=136.682,P〈0.001);各年龄组共发生肾功能不全者为1841例,年龄〈40岁、40~60岁、60一80岁、i〉80岁组分别为50、749、9125、130例,发生率分别为14.4%、13.8%、27.0%和54.6%(x2=423.431,P〈0.001);Logistic回归分析结果显示,影响发生肾功能不全事件的因素有性别、年龄、收缩压、甘油三酯、血尿酸、血肌酐及尿素氮(P均〈0.05);年龄60~80岁组发生。肾功能不全的危险为年龄〈40岁组的5.50倍,年龄≥80岁组发生。肾功能不全的危险为年龄〈40岁组的82.51倍(P均〈0.05)。结论男性人群、高龄、高收缩压水平、高甘油三酯、高尿酸、高血肌酐及高尿素氮是糖尿病人群发生肾功能不全的影响因素;年龄60~80岁及≥80岁患者发生肾功能不全的风险最大。Objective To investigate the distribution and effective factors of estimated glomerular filtration rate(eGFR) in diabetic patients. Methods A total of 9396 diabetic patients who had participated in the health examination from 2006 to 2007 were selected as the observation cohort. The observation population was divided into four groups according to their age, including the less 40 years group, the 40 - 60 years group, the 60-80 years group and the more than 80 years group. Defined renal insufficiency as eGFR 〈 60 ml/(min. 1.73 m2). Multiple logistic regression analysis was used to analyze the effective factors of renal insufficiency. Results ( 1 ) The eGER of all subjects was decrease as the age increase ( F = 136. 682, P 〈 0. 001 ). (2)There were 1814 subjects with renal insufficiency in the health examinations during 2006 to 2007. There are 50,749,9125 and 130 cases respectively with renal insufficiency at the group of 〈 40 years, 40 - 60 years ,60 -80 years old and 〉180 years old respectively. The incidences of renal insufficiency in the four group was 14. 4%, 13.8% ,27.0% and 54. 6% respectively ( X2 = 423.431, P 〈 0. 001 ). (3) Multiple logistic regression analysis showed that the gender, age, systolic blood pressure, triglyceride, uric acid, creatinine and urea nitrogen were the factors related to renal insufficiency in diabetic patients ( P 〈 0.05 ). ( 4 ) Compared with the group of 〈 40 years, the incident rates of renal insufficiency was 5.50 folds ( 3.69 - 8.20 ) and 82. 51 folds (43.01 - 158.26) respectively at 60 - 80 years group and i〉 80 years old group. Conclusion ( 1 ) Diabetic patients with male, older, higher levels of systolic blood pressure, triglyceride, uric acid, creatinine and urea nitrogen were with high risk of renal insufficiency. ( 2 ) The top risk factors of renal insufficiency was age between 60 - 80 years.
